Yes, you can use a tenugui as a bath towel. Although it is thinner than traditional towels, its quick-drying and lightweight properties make it ideal for travel or gym use. Simply wring it out to dry quickly and use again.

What is a tenugui?
A tenugui is a traditional Japanese cloth that is usually made of cotton and often used for various purposes including as a hand towel or wrapping material.
Is a tenugui effective for drying?
Yes, while thinner than regular towels, a tenugui is effective due to its quick-drying properties, making it great for immediate use.
Can a tenugui be used in the gym?
Absolutely! Its lightweight and fast-drying nature makes it an ideal gym accessory, particularly for wiping sweat.
How should I care for my tenugui?
To care for your tenugui, wash it gently with mild detergent and avoid bleach. Air drying is recommended to keep it in good condition.
